True Horror  
by YuriTachikawa
August 26th, 2020, 1:39am
Rating: 9.0  / 10.0
If you're looking for a story, this is not for you, it doesn't have any conclusion or reason. It's more about the happenings and the unsettling feeling that is supposed to be invoked. You should be warned though, after reading this you will feel drained, I can't really explain it, but as the journey progresses you can really feel how the protagonists lose hope. The way it is objectively narrated adds to this feeling. The pacing is a bit slow in the middle but gets better to the end.
I love his art, I think we can all agree that his drawings give this eerie vibe that draws you in (not necessarily because of the spirals). When I say 'true horror' I mean that there is more than jump scares or gore and Junji Ito proves that, I've walked past a *colorful* drawing of a spiral, months after I've read Uzumaki (and wasn't aware of this manga anymore), and felt this unsettling dread spread through my whole body.

Maybe it isn't perfect, but I enjoyed it and I would recommend it.  
by ForeignerChan
April 3rd, 2018, 2:00pm
Rating: N/A
The title says it all. I liked this manga for a lot of reasons: the subject is original, the story is engaging, the characters are likeable and credible, the art is very nice.

Actually, the only "flaw" I could find is the fact the manga seems to be spit in two: the first part is episodic (it talks about several odd events that don't seem to be connected except for the fact that they all involve a spiral), while the second part starts focusing more on the main plot. But after finishing reading the manga, I realized that the first part was meant to explain how it all began, case by case. So that wasn't a flaw at all.
Then maybe the fact that the story doesn't have a moral? At least, if there was, I couldn't find it. That could be a flaw. But to be honest, even without a moral, I enjoyed the reading.

As most of the reviewers wrote, I wouldn't recommend it to someone who is looking for a real horror manga, but if you are into odd stories, this manga is the right one. Also, this is more of a light reading, so don't expect too much.
